Joanie Lynn Pegram Ferris, 50, of Old Mill Farm Road, went home to be with her Saviour Friday, July 14, 2006, at her home after a two-year illness.
The funeral will be at 4 p.m. Sunday at Reedy Creek Baptist Church, where she was a member, by the Rev. Egbert Craven. Burial will follow in Good Hope United Methodist Church Cemetery.
Mrs. Ferris was born Jan. 22, 1956, to Joe Arvel Pegram and Juanita Mae Preston. She worked for Scan Sort as a group leader. At her church, she was a member of the Ladies Fellowship, was a Sunday school teacher, sang in the choir and taught children's church.
